Position Title: Automation Tester Freelance (Functional & Automation Expert) Company: E-Solution Location: Casablanca Level: Bac+5 (Master’s) Experience: 3 to 5 years (Minimum 4 years requested) Application Deadline: Friday, November 21, 2025
Strengthen Our Quality and Test Hub
E-Solution is seeking an experienced Automation Tester Freelance to reinforce its Quality and Test department. We need a consultant with a strong functional and automation background, capable of designing, writing, and automating test scenarios, while actively contributing to the validation of application developments. This QA Specialist Casablanca role is critical to our continuous integration and delivery pipeline.
The consultant will work on projects utilizing the Agile / Scrum methodology, collaborating directly with development, product, and Continuous Integration (CI/CD) teams.
Core Missions: Functional and Automation Expertise
As an Automation Tester Freelance, your responsibilities are split across two high-value areas:
1. Functional Expertise:
- Analyze functional requirements and draft corresponding test plans.
- Define and document test scenarios using Xray (integrated into Jira).
- Participate in functional specification reviews and requirement validation.
- Execute manual tests and ensure rigorous anomaly tracking in Jira.
2. Automation & CI/CD Integration:
- Automate recurrent functional test cases using Robot Framework CI/CD.
- Develop and maintain automated test scripts using the Gherkin language (BDD).
- Integrate automated tests into the CI/CD pipeline, primarily via Jenkins.
- Ensure the maintenance and continuous update of the automation repository.
3. Monitoring and Reporting:
- Track testing progress (coverage rate, success rate, anomalies).
- Generate execution reports via Xray and share them with project teams.
- Collaborate closely with development, product, and quality teams to ensure compliance.
Required Profile for the QA Specialist Casablanca Role
This role requires a high level of expertise in Robot Framework CI/CD and methodologies:
- Education: Bac+5 in Computer Science, Software Quality, or equivalent.
- Experience: Minimum 4 years in a similar Automation Tester Freelance role.
- Technical Skills: Mastery of Jira/Xray, Robot Framework, Jenkins, Gherkin (BDD), and functional/regression testing concepts. Knowledge of Python, Selenium, or API testing is a major plus.
- Soft Skills: Rigor, analytical thinking, sense of detail, team spirit, autonomy, and proactivity.
- Languages: Professional French and Technical English.

